General Discussion / Scavenger Hunt - Again.« on: January 31, 2010, 02:54:59 am »
First one was so much fun, I'm going to do this again on Feb 21
This time I'm giving a tad more notice and trying for a neutral timezone so as many as possible can participate. [SIZE=16]Rules.[/SIZE] 1) Teams of 2-8 players - you make the teams, not me. You can form them before the event or from whomever shows up. My only request is that vetran players and novice players make an effort to team up together to share the Layonara experience and get to know one another. 2) Teams must stay together. No splitting in different directions to cover as much ground as possible. The only exception would be if particular players were mechanically (ie less than level 10 needing to enter an advanced craft hall) or RP (paladin of Toran entering another temple) able to follow. Those players would wait for their team at the most sensible spot, not wander off on their own. You may band together to accomplish a difficult task. 3) You have four hours to gather as many of the items as possible. You must return to the start point within the time allowed to qualify. In the event of a tie, the team with the most items in the shortest time wins. Time is recorded when at least 75% of the team is back. Last time we had some lag issues that almost disqualified a team - pay attention but I will make some allowances for slower computer systems. 4) Some items will have enough for all teams to collect and others will be limited. Limited items are a first come, first served basis. You can, as stategy take multiple items unless I have a sign or tag not to. This can be part of your strategy if you wish. I will do my best to make the location as unabigious as possible, however as brilliant as a I am :p I do not know every spawn on the server. If you are after bees knees and find a source that I was unaware of, you may be out of luck. This happened last time, I will try not to let it happen again. 5) If you are playing on the servers while I am setting up - please don't take the items from the scavenger teams. 6) There will be items that will require killing an animals/creatures to obtain and others that could be obtained by passive means or gathering. This will allow more passive characters the choice to participate in a non violent manner without direct GM intervention, but choices and RP within the group are part of the fun. Items will be tagged special for the scavenger hunt such that raiding of guild hall supplies and personal stores will not give an advantage. 7) Besides bragging rights, the winning team will have an undetermined prize pot and a "really nice item" to roll for within the group. Second place will have a consolation prize for team members. Please note - this is for all levels. There will be items that only an epic party might obtain and those that players of any level may obtain. It it more about knowing where things are on the server and exploration than levels. Please don't feel intimidated if you are a lower level. This is a great oppertunity to explore and get to know your fellow players. The following users thanked this post: Talia
